The productivity of a variety is a characteristic of its biological potential, which manifests itself through interaction with production conditions. It is divided into potential yield, possible under ideal environmental parameters, and actual (planned) yield, which depends on the actual level of agronomic practices, seed quality, and the climatic characteristics of a specific year. The choice of a variety is based on the correspondence of its genetic capabilities to the intensity level of technologies used on the farm.
Yield metrics in centners or tons per hectare are used to assess productivity, and in greenhouses, in kilograms per square meter. Since crop moisture content at harvest can vary, data is recalculated to a standard moisture content to ensure accurate varietal comparison. This complex trait is formed from yield structure elements, such as stand density, grain per ear, thousand kernel weight, and plant survival.
Productivity assessment during variety testing is conducted in comparison with a standard variety on plots with multiple replications to ensure data reliability. For statistical confirmation of differences, analysis of variance methods are used at a 95% confidence level. A condition for recommending a variety for introduction is its statistically significant superiority over the standard in productivity or other economically useful traits, with an increase of 8–10% considered a substantial basis for further study.
